理解 Javascript 的 sort() 函数
JavaScript 中的 sort() 方法用于按特定顺序排列数组的元素。为了按数字顺序对数组进行排序,提供了一个回调函数作为参数。此回调函数会比较每对元素,并根据比较结果返回一个值。
回调函数采用两个参数:“a”和“b”,代表要比较的元素。以下逻辑用于确定排序顺序:
为了说明这一点,请考虑数组 [25, 8, 7, 41]。
执行 sort() 方法
sort() 方法迭代调用回调函数来比较元素。发生以下比较顺序:
合并排序集
每次比较后,排序的元素都会被合并。最终排序后的数组为 [8, 7, 25, 41]。
以上是JavaScript 的'sort()”函数如何处理数值数组?的详细内容。更多信息请关注PHP中文网其他相关文章!